Marry Me Chicken

Marry Me Chicken is tender chicken breasts cooked in a creamy sauce that is bursting with flavor from the fresh tomatoes.  It's a delicious marriage of simple ingredients that you can make in no time, even on busy weeknights.

Best Marry Me Chicken Recipe

This easy to make tender juicy chicken is fancy enough for company, but easy enough for a quick weeknight meal.

Prep Time5 minutes mins
Cook Time30 minutes mins
Total Time35 minutes mins
Course: Lunch or Dinner
Cuisine: American
Servings: 6 servings
Calories: 1089kcal
Author: Deb Clark

Equipment

  • Large Skillet

Ingredients

  • 4 boneless skinless chicken breasts
  • ½ teaspoon salt and ¼ te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on butter
  • 1 onion finely diced
  • 3 cloves garlic minced
  • 1 cup chicken broth
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• ½ c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ning or a mix of dried oregano, basil, and thyme
  • ½ teaspoon red pepper flakes adjust to your spice preference
  • 1 cup cherry tomatoes halved
  • Fresh parsley chopped (for garnish)

Instructions

  • Season the chicken breasts with salt and black pepper on both sides.
  •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the chicken breasts and cook for about 5-6 minutes per side until they are golden brown and cooked through. Remove the chicken from the skillet and set aside.
  • In the same skillet,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and garlic, sauté until the onion is translucent and fragrant.
  • Pour in the chicken broth, scraping the bottom of the skillet to deglaze and pick up any browned bits. Let the broth simmer for a couple of minutes to reduce slightly.
  • Lower the heat and stir in the heavy cream, grated Parmesan cheese, Italian seasoning, and red pepper flakes. Stir continuously until the sauce becomes creamy and well combined. Simmer for 2-3 minutes to allow the flavors to meld.
  • Add the halved cherry tomatoes to the sauce, and let them simmer for an additional 2-3 minutes until they slightly soften.
  • Return the cooked chicken breasts to the skillet, nestling them into the sauce. Simmer for another 2-3 minutes to let the chicken absorb some of the creamy goodness.
  • Taste the sauce and adjust the seasoning with salt and pepper if needed.
  • Garnish with chopped fresh parsley for a pop of color and added freshness.

FAQ's

Why is it called Marry Me Chicken? 

This recipe got its name because it tastes so good that it will make you want to put a ring on it! It's marriage proposal time! ❤️

Is this the same as Tuscan chicken? 

It is very similar however Tuscan chicken usually contains sun-dried tomatoes and spinach, and we left those out of this recipe. 

What should the internal temperature of the chicken be? 

Should be  165℉/74℃. Using a meat thermometer is the best way to ensure it's cooked properly.

Test kitchen tips

  • Make sure that your skillet is hot before you start to sear this chicken. This prevents the chicken from becoming tough and gives you a nice crust on the outside. 
  • Use a wooden spoon or spatula to scrape the bottom of the pan well. You want to get the brown bits into your sauce for the flavor. 
  • If you are on a low carb diet you can serve this delicious chicken recipe over a bed of cauliflower rice. 
  • The cooking time may vary based on the thickness of your piece of chicken. You can save a little time by using thin chicken breasts. 

Variations

  • Feel free to swap out the Italian seasoning for your favorite fresh herbs, fresh thyme, and rosemary will blend so well into this parmesan cream sauce.
  • Spinach and sundried tomatoes are great additions. Add it to the creamy sauce when you add the chicken back in.
  • Add some extra flavor to the delicious sauce by swapping out the chicken broth for white wine. 
  • Instead of fresh cherry tomatoes, you can use sun-dried tomatoes if you prefer the flavor of those. 

Storage

Refrigerate - Store leftover chicken in an airtight container for 2-3 days. 

Freezer - Due to the dairy in the creamy sauce I recommend that you do not freeze this. 

Reheat - You can reheat the chicken in the microwave on 50% power for 1-2 minutes or until warm all the way through. However, my favorite way to reheat it is in a skillet over medium-low heat until it is completely warm.
